Mexico to file criminal complaints over ICE custody deaths

Mexico is preparing to file criminal complaints in the United States concerning the deaths of Mexican nationals while in ICE custody. This move escalates beyond previous diplomatic protests, aiming to compel U.S. prosecutors to investigate the incidents as criminal matters. The Mexican government has expressed a commitment to pursuing all available actions to address these deaths, highlighting an alarming trend that has drawn scrutiny from international rights advocates and the UN High Commissioner for Human Rights.
